The former presidential candidate has already racked up endorsements from two sitting Republican statewide officials: Secretary of State Frank LaRose and Treasurer Robert Sprague.
Vivek Ramaswamy has filed paperwork to run for governor of Ohio. He is expected to launch his campaign later in February.
Ramaswamy plans to formally kick off his campaign later this month with stops around the state including in Ohio.
